Officers from District A-7 welcomed students from the Mario Umana Academy in East Boston to the A-7 District Station for a behind-the-scenes visit.
Our officers provided transportation for the students before giving them a tour of the station, introducing them to the officers who serve their neighborhood, and answering questions about what it’s like to be a Boston Police officer.
To cap off a fun day of learning and community engagement, students enjoyed free ice cream courtesy of the BPD Ice Cream Truck and our partners at HP Hood.
